About
Shin-chan: Shiro and the Coal Town is a single player casual simulation game. It was developed by h.a.n.d., Inc. and was released on October 23, 2024. It received mostly positive reviews from critics and overwhelmingly positive reviews from players.
Shin chan starts a mysterious daily routine, traveling between two worlds: the Village in Akita and Coal Town.











- The game offers a relaxing and cozy experience, perfect for unwinding and enjoying summer vibes.
- Visually stunning with charming hand-painted backgrounds and a whimsical story that captures childhood wonder.
- Gameplay is simple and accessible, allowing players to engage in enjoyable activities like bug catching, fishing, and gardening without the pressure of complex mechanics.
- The gameplay can become repetitive, especially towards the end, with resource gathering feeling grindy and tedious.
- Some quests lack clear direction, leading to confusion and frustration for players trying to progress.
- The narrative includes jarring themes that may be unsettling for some players, contrasting sharply with the otherwise lighthearted gameplay.

The story of "Shin Chan: Shiro and the Coal Town" is a heartwarming blend of whimsical adventure and slice-of-life elements, exploring themes of tradition, environmental issues, and childhood curiosity against a backdrop of contrasting landscapes. While the narrative features a charming overarching plot and engaging side quests, some players find the pacing slow and the main missions lack clear direction, leading to occasional frustration. Overall, the game successfully maintains a lighthearted tone while addressing deeper societal themes, making it a unique and enjoyable experience.
